1 Introduction
This document is a Requirements Specification for the control system
inventories. This specification has been structured based on the guidelines provided by the
IEEE standard.
1.1 Purpose
The purpose of this document is to create an information system for the
control and management of inventory for a bookstore, specifying the requirements
functional and non-functional requirements that the system will have for its proper development.

2.4 Restrictions
The system must be connected to the internet.
The system must be secure for users.
There should not be two users with the same name.

The interface with users will consist of an advantage where they will be able to enter their
data and log into the system, where they will be able to access their respective products in their
inventory, the box and the ability to update the product information and also of the
users.
It will be essential to have equipment in good condition that meets the requirements already.
established.
The teams where the system will be installed must communicate with each other, and
update with each modification of information.
Validate the user: Users must identify themselves with their email.
email and password
Inventory control information system
Page 20
System Requirements Specification
Alert the user: the system will send an alert message when the
the stock of a product has reached the minimum.
Reports: The system will allow us to generate reports that inform us about
best-selling products in a given time.
Buying: It will allow the user to access the cash register and be able to deduct the money.
from the payment to the distributors.
